The Geeks Shall Inherit the Earth: Alexandra Robbins Interview

The era of the geeks is at hand, according to Alexandra Robbins and her "quirk" theory.

Robbins is a journalist and author who studies the social behavior and experiences of teens. In her latest book, The Geeks Shall Inherit the Earth, Robbins follows the lives of seven very different students, while also observing and interviewing school admin, staff, and students.

Through her research, she allows readers to catch a glimpse of the social struggles many young adults face and develops the "quirk theory" that celebrates individuality.
